Heat Resistant!: Dishes & Serving Utensils

finally! Someone understands how to make a carafe! Here's why I love this one: - It's not plastic. It's already better than the standard Rubbermaid version! Now you can brew iced tea right in the carafe you keep it in. This is borosilicate glass that can withstand high temperatures. It's borosilicate! heavy things. Not your standard beautiful glass carafe to worry about. I have a feeling that carafes are either some kind of plastic or nice glass that's too thin to stand up to heavy use...it's not too heavy, not as thick as pyrex, which is nice. - Easy to pour. It's not too heavy and has a nice, sturdy handle. It has a spout that not all decanters have (why?). It has a lid with an inspection hole! - Easy to store - It has a lid! And it's not that tall so you can easily store it in the fridge or on a cupboard shelf when not in use (thanks!) - Attractive. Thank goodness it's not some old-fashioned frosted glass. It doesn't have bright frosty patterns... it's modern and clean. - Easy to clean. Although it tapers towards the top, it is neither too tall nor too narrow for easy cleaning from the inside. - Cheap. I didn't pay for it but the price is very affordable for what it is. This is an attractive and practical item that looks great in a casual or formal setting. good size From this amount you can get 4-6 decent lemonades. That's 88 ounces and 6 sodas of 12 ounces = 72 ounces.
